Yep, I will go with /health and /alive

Why not /healthy? It's more aligned with /alive if that's a preference, but /health feels disjointed from /alive. If you're healthy, you're alive, but they're not dually synonymous. You could be alive, but unwell... Whereas, /health could be anything, what does this actually report? It is a bit, or some status object? Is it an enum with three possible values; Healthy, Degraded, and Unhealthy? If the latter is the case, then I'd assume that we wouldn't want /alive as I'd expect that to be either true or false.

When you say "and", are you using both, as in multiple routes that resolve with the same check? Just curious about this naming convention. I agree with Brendan Burns (@brendandburns) on this one, but still a bit conflicted.

/health does a deep health check and checks all dependencies. It'll eventually also return detailed health status (it'll return a single result today, healthy, unhealthy, degraded)
/alive does a self-check without checking dependencies.
